Château Les Grands Chênes is a leading Médoc Cru Bourgeois property that is now producing wines comparable in quality to many 4éme and 5éme Cru Classé châteaux. It is located at Saint-Christoly-De-Médoc in the far north of the Médoc appellation. It can trace its history back to the 14th century, although its past was generally undistinguished until 1981 when Jacqueline Gauzy-Darricade acquired it. She extensively replanted many of the vineyards as well as investing heavily in a new winery.

The property consists of 7 hectares of vineyards located on gravel rich soil close to the Gironde Estuary. The wine is a blend of 65% Cabernet Sauvignon, 30% Merlot and 5% Cabernet Franc and is matured in small oak barrels (one-third new) for 15-18 months. Celebrated oenologist Jacques Boisssenot is a consultant and the wines are now renowned for their depth of fruit and complexity. The wines remain very keenly priced.
